Pt is 89, diagnosed with prostate cancer that has metasticized to the bone and elsewhere. He is on palliative/comfort care only. Family is having a difficult time deciding on placement following discharge from hospital.

1. Chronic pain r/t (insert long patho of pain here) AEB facial grimacing, groaning

2. Alteration in family process r/t illness of family member AEB blah blah blah

3. Risk for impaired skin integrity r/t immobility

4. Risk for infection r/t depression of immune system (pt was treated with strontium)

Those sound good. How about some psycosocial dx.

1) Fear/Grieving r/t impending death aeb expressions of guilt,anger or sorrow

2)powerlessness r/t loss over control of life decisions aeb witdrawal or decreased participation inadl's
